Specialty coating refers to protective systems applied over concrete to create a durable, sealed surface. These aren’t your basic paint products. Industrial floor coatings use advanced chemistry—epoxy resins, polyurethane compounds, or polyaspartic formulations—that bond directly to concrete at a molecular level.
The coating creates a seamless barrier between your concrete and everything trying to damage it. Chemical spills, oil leaks, heavy impacts, and abrasive materials all get stopped at the surface instead of penetrating into the concrete itself. Epoxy floor coatings consist of two components—a resin and a hardening agent—that chemically react when mixed. This reaction creates an incredibly hard surface that bonds permanently to properly prepared concrete. The result is a floor that resists abrasion, impacts, and chemical damage far better than bare concrete ever could.
The durability comes from how the coating penetrates into the concrete’s pores before hardening. Unlike paint that sits on top, epoxy becomes part of the floor structure. This means it won’t peel or flake off under normal use. Polyurethane coatings offer flexibility that epoxy can’t match. Where epoxy creates a hard, rigid surface, polyurethane has some give to it. This flexibility helps in environments with significant temperature swings or where the building structure shifts slightly over time. The coating moves with the concrete instead of cracking under stress.
These coatings also resist UV exposure better than standard epoxy. If your facility has large windows, skylights, or areas where sunlight hits the floor directly, polyurethane prevents the yellowing and degradation that can happen with epoxy. This makes polyurethane a smart choice for showrooms, retail spaces, or any commercial facility where appearance matters alongside durability.
Polyaspartic coatings represent newer technology that combines benefits from both epoxy and polyurethane systems. They cure extremely fast—often in just a few hours—which means your facility gets back to full operation much quicker. This rapid curing happens across a wide temperature range, giving installers more flexibility in scheduling and reducing the weather-related delays that can push projects back.
The speed advantage matters more than you might think. Every hour your facility is down for floor work costs money in lost productivity. Polyaspartic systems can often be applied and cured overnight, letting your team walk on the floor the next morning. These coatings also provide excellent chemical resistance and durability. They stand up to oils, solvents, acids, and cleaning chemicals without breaking down. The UV stability means colors stay true and the surface doesn’t degrade in areas with natural light exposure. For facilities that need both performance and appearance, polyaspartic coatings deliver on both fronts.
The application process for these specialty coatings requires skill and proper surface preparation. The concrete must be clean, dry, and properly profiled to ensure the coating bonds correctly. Any shortcuts in prep work lead to premature failure—peeling, bubbling, or delamination that defeats the entire purpose of the coating. This is why professional installation matters more than the coating product itself.

Slip-resistant surfaces do double duty by protecting your budget and your people. Adding texture to floor coatings through aggregates or specialized topcoats creates traction that prevents slip-and-fall accidents. These incidents cost employers billions each year in medical expenses, lost work time, and liability claims. For facilities in Macomb County, MI and Oakland County, MI where winter weather means wet floors from snow and salt, slip resistance isn’t optional—it’s essential.
The texture in slip-resistant coatings comes from materials mixed into or broadcast onto the coating while it’s still wet. Sand, aluminum oxide, or polymer grit all create surfaces that maintain grip even when wet or contaminated with oils. The level of texture can be customized based on your facility’s needs, from light pedestrian areas to heavy industrial zones where forklifts and machinery operate.
Cleaning coated floors takes a fraction of the time compared to bare or poorly protected concrete. The sealed surface prevents dirt, oils, and contaminants from soaking into the concrete’s porous structure. Everything stays on the surface where it can be mopped or swept away easily. This means your janitorial staff spends less time scrubbing and more time on other tasks.
Chemical spills that would permanently stain bare concrete wipe up cleanly from properly coated floors. This matters in facilities where hydraulic fluids, oils, solvents, or other chemicals are part of daily operations. Instead of watching stains spread and set into your concrete, you simply clean the surface and move on. The coating’s chemical resistance prevents damage while making cleanup straightforward.
The durability of specialty coating also means fewer repairs over time. Unprotected concrete develops cracks, chips, and surface damage that require patching, grinding, or complete resurfacing. Each repair means downtime, disruption to operations, and expense. Coated floors handle the same abuse without breaking down, eliminating most of these repair cycles for years at a time.

The seamless nature of specialty coating eliminates the joints and gaps found in tile or other flooring systems. These joints collect dirt, harbor bacteria, and create cleaning challenges. In food service, healthcare, or pharmaceutical facilities where sanitation is critical, seamless floors make it possible to maintain the cleanliness standards required by regulations and inspections.
Maintenance protocols for coated floors are straightforward. Regular sweeping or dust mopping removes loose debris. Periodic wet mopping with mild detergent handles the rest. There’s no need for special cleaning products, expensive equipment, or intensive labor. This simplicity reduces both the time and cost of keeping floors clean and presentable.
